Phase 1/2 PEEL-224 for Relapsed or Refractory Sarcomas

This study is testing a new drug called PEEL-224, combined with two existing drugs, Vincristine and Temozolomide, for adolescents and young adults with sarcomas that have come back or not responded to previous treatments. This includes Ewing Sarcoma and Desmoplastic Small Round Cell Tumor, among other sarcomas. The study aims to find a safe dose of PEEL-224 (Phase 1) and then see how well this combination works (Phase 2). You may be able to join if you are between 12 and 49 years old and have a sarcoma that has relapsed or is refractory. The study is enrolling 63 participants.

Study design
This is a Phase 1/2, open-label, single-arm study, meaning all participants will receive the study treatment, and everyone involved will know which treatment is being given. It is not randomized. The study plans to enroll 63 participants.

Eligibility criteria

Inclusion

Patients in all cohorts must have relapsed or refractory disease after standard therapy.
Patients must have:
Evaluable or measurable disease; and
Histologic diagnosis of sarcoma
EWS cohort: Patients must have:
RECIST measurable disease at study entry;
Histologic diagnosis consistent with Ewing sarcoma; and
Molecular evidence of a FET-ETS family translocation including but not limited to any of the following:
EWSR1::FLI1, EWSR1::ERG, EWSR1::ETV1, EWSR1::ETV4, EWSR1::FEV, FUS::FLI1, FUS::ERG
DSRCT cohort: Patients must have:
RECIST measurable disease at study entry;
Histologic diagnosis consistent with DSRCT; and
Molecular evidence of an EWSR1::WT1 fusion
Other sarcoma cohort: Patients must have:
RECIST evaluable or measurable disease; and
Histologic diagnosis of sarcoma. Patients with EWS or DSRCT with evaluable but not measurable disease may participate in this cohort.
Slots in this cohort will include three dedicated slots for patients with rhabdomyosarcoma, three dedicated slots for patients with osteosarcoma and three dedicated slots for patients with other translocation-associated round cell sarcomas.
Age: ≥ 12 years and ≤ 49 years.
Weight: Patients must be ≥ 40 kg.
Performance Status: Karnofsky ≥ 50% for patients \>16 year of age and Lansky ≥ 50% for patients ≤ 16 years of age. (see Appendix A for definitions of Lansky and Karnofsky Performance Status).

Exclusion

Patients who have received prior treatment with PEEL-224.
Patients who have had progressive disease while receiving irinotecan and temozolomide in combination will be excluded from the Phase 2 EWS and DSRCT cohorts only.
Participants who are receiving any other anti-cancer agents for this condition.
Patients receiving strong P450 CYP1A2 and CYP3A4 inhibitors and/or inducers with 14 days of the first planned dose of PEEL-224. NOTE: levofloxacin is permitted and preferred over ciprofloxacin for patients needing a fluoroquinolone.
Patients who have received a solid organ or allogeneic stem cell transplant
Pregnant participants, given that the effects of PEEL-224 on the developing human fetus are unknown.
Breastfeeding mothers, because there is an unknown risk for adverse events in nursing infants secondary to treatment of the mother with PEEL-224.
Patients with a history of allergic reactions attributed to PEGylated drugs, camptothecins, temozolomide or vincristine.
Patients with uncontrolled intercurrent illness including, but not limited to, ongoing or active infection, symptomatic congestive heart failure, unstable angina pectoris, cardiac arrhythmia, or psychiatric illness/social situations that would limit compliance with study requirements.
  • Maximum Tolerated Dose (MTD) (Phase 1)Up to 35 days

    The MTD is determined by a Continual Reassessment Method (CRM) design and defined as the dose level with the posterior probability of dose-limiting toxicity (DLT) closest to the target toxicity rate of 0.3 with a maximum sample size of 15. The DLT observation period is up to 35 days long, beginning at the first dose of any of the three drugs in cycle 1 and ending at the occurrence of a DLT.

  • Number of Participants with Dose-Limiting Toxicities (Phase 1)Up to 35 days

    Any ≥ Grade 2 CTCAE v5 adverse events that are possibly, probably, or definitely attributable to the combination of Vincristine, PEEL-224, and Temozolomide and within the first 35 days, beginning at the first dose of any of the three drugs in cycle 1 and ending at the occurrence of DLT or at the start of treatment in cycle 2 (whichever occurs first). To be evaluable for dose-limiting toxicity, a participant must also receive at least 75% of prescribed agents in cycle 1 and be followed for at least 35 days during cycle 1 or to the start of cycle 2 (whichever occurs first).

  • Number of Participants with DLTs (Phase 2)Up to 35 days

    A safety monitoring rule will be applied to Phase 2 of the study for the overall participant cohort. The DLT observation period is up to 35 days long, beginning at the first dose of any of the three drugs in cycle 1 and ending at the occurrence of DLT or at the start of treatment in cycle 2 (whichever occurs first).

  • Objective Response Rate EWS Cohort (Phase 2)Up to 5 years (based on accrual duration of 2 years)

    ORR is defined as the percentage of participants achieving complete response (CR) or partial response (PR) on treatment based on RECIST 1.1 criteria. Evaluable participants must have measurable disease at screening, be treated at RP2D dose, have received at least one dose of study drug, and either have evidence of clinical progression or have had at least one follow-up disease evaluation of their RECIST measurable disease after initiation of protocol therapy. The proportion of responders is calculated as the (number of responders) / (number of evaluable participants).
